Mobility Scooters For Sale Near Me

You might consider purchasing a used mobility scooter if you are in search of one. They are lightweight and can be disassembled for easy transport. They are ideal for travelling in public or private transport.

A frontal lug-box allows you to carry your gadgets and bags easily. They are sturdy and able to take on a variety terrains.

Scooters for sale near me

Mobility scooters are three- or four-wheeled vehicles powered by batteries. They're specifically designed for those with limited mobility or Mobility Scooters For Sale who are unable to walk. The padded back and seat let users sit comfortably while the tiller (similar to a bicycle steering wheel) is used to control both forward and reverse movements. A majority of models also come with features like headlights or storage baskets. Some of these scooters cost more than $6,000, while others are priced at less than $500. However you can find used models for a much cheaper price, particularly when you shop in the right location.

purchasing a second-hand vehicle is a responsible choice that will save you time and money. It's not just an option to save energy and resources, but also to reduce the amount of waste going into landfills. A second hand mobility scooters for sale-hand mobility scooter can be a great way to see whether this type of aid is right for you.

You can purchase a second-hand scooter in a variety of places, including online, local medical supply stores and mobility scooter dealers. A reputable dealer will help you get the most for your money, and will ensure that you get a machine that is fully functional.

Another important thing to consider is the age of the batteries on the scooter. If they are old and the scooter isn't able to have enough power, and could be unsafe to use. Most scooter batteries last eighteen to twenty-four months, but it's a good idea to make replacement plans as soon as you start notice that they're not able to hold charges as well as they used to.

If you are looking for a second-hand scooter, make sure to ask about the warranty and service history. If the scooter has been in a shop, be sure it's properly maintained and cleaned and that it has been tested to ensure it's operating properly. You should also examine the tyres to make sure that they're not worn or have any infills.

You can also purchase a scooter from a private seller via eBay or Craigslist. However it is essential to be aware that the quality of used scooters can differ in a wide range. Visit a local mobility scooter dealer or medical supply store to ensure that you're buying a high-quality scooter. These dealers will be equipped to show you the product and provide you with an accurate idea of how the scooter performs in your specific environment. You can also ask for the policy of return if you aren't happy with the product. This is a huge advantage in comparison to buying from an online retailer.

Scooters for sale UK

Mobility aids are needed by many people, regardless of whether they suffer from a disability or are elderly. Mobility scooters are an excellent option for move around, since they're secure and comfortable. They can be more affordable than other modes of transport, such as cars or buses. They have their disadvantages, and it is essential that you consider your budget and requirements before purchasing one. Also, you should determine if you need a license to operate the scooter.

There are a variety of scooters that are available for purchase as well as a range of used models. They range from lightweight scooters that can be transported easily and heavy-duty models that have a high maximum payload and bigger tires. There are scooters that can be operated on the road, as well as those specifically designed to be used on pavements. If you intend to drive a scooter on the road, it is important to make sure that it's registered as a class 3 vehicle.

An old-fashioned mobility scooter can be a great option if you are looking to save money on a new model. They are available from a variety of places that offer mobility services, such as specialized shops and private sellers. You can often get a good deal based on the age and condition. It is also advisable to check for a warranty or service history prior to making a final decision.

The best places to buy used mobility scooters are reliable specialists in mobility scooters. They will examine the scooter thoroughly and provide the full report. They will also offer the option of a part exchange that allows you to swap your old mobility scooter for a more modern model. In addition, they offer a range of financing options.

If you are looking for a used scooter it is crucial to think about your needs and the environment where you plan to use it. A scooter can be a valuable investment, so it is important to select one that meets your requirements. Some scooters are equipped with frontal lug boxes that can be used for holding personal items and bags. This is more secure than tying them to the chair.

If you're interested in buying a scooter, you should take the time to investigate different models and brands. Compare prices, warranties and the quality of the parts. You should also look through reviews of various scooters before settling on a particular model. You can also request a demo from a dealer to try the scooter to ensure it's suitable for you. Many dealers also offer a free delivery and collection service.

Scooters for sale online

A mobility scooter can make it easier for you to move around when you're suffering from an injury, illness or simply have a lower physical ability. While some may view them a sign of age and decline but they're actually elegant and stylish. They come with modern conveniences such as padded seats and storage baskets, and are reasonably priced when you look at second-hand options. There are many used scooters available on websites like eBay, mobility scooters for sale Craigslist, Facebook Marketplace and even local medical supply shops and scooter dealerships. However, before you purchase one, you should do your research and ask the right questions.

First, you need to decide which location and how to make use of the scooter. Are you planning to use it mostly indoors or on rough terrain? If so, a lightweight scooter designed to be compact and easily disassembled might be the best option. Or, a smaller scooter that can be driven both indoors as well as outdoors might best suit your needs.

It is also important to consider the age of the scooter as this will affect how well it performs and if spare parts are easily available. If you're buying from a private vendor be sure to verify how long they have owned the scooter, and then test it to see how the tires are performing. "If they're worn out or flat, out, you will be able to hear a noticeable thump and thump when you travel over bumps," warns Yaremus.

If you purchase at a mobility shop the staff have inside knowledge of how scooters work. They also know what to look out for in terms of performance and condition. They can also assist you in choosing the right model to meet your requirements. In addition to examining the scooter itself you should also inquire about its service history and the frequency with which it was used.

Buying a scooter online is also a good option it allows you to compare prices from different retailers. Be aware that the majority of dealers offer delivery to customers within a specific territory and will charge a restocking fees if you decide to return the item. It's also important to remember that most sellers on the internet won't give you the original copy in the event of a issue. It's better to purchase a new or used scooter from a reputable dealer that has an actual shop. You'll be assured that you're buying the best scooter and a reputable warranty.
